The Purple Kush strain of marijuana was initially named the Oaksterdam, and it is a strain of marijuana that is pure Indica. This weed is a combination between the Hindu Kush strain and the Purple Afghani cannabis strain, and they create an extremely potent offspring with THC levels as high as 17% to 28%.
Different marijuana strains have their own distinct smells, tastes, and appearances. This is due to strain genetics, terpene profile, and the grower’s expertise. For example, the plant of this strain of marijuana has bright green buds, and there are purple hues on the buds. In addition, this weed has an aroma that is reminiscent of grapefruit and spice.
The purple kush strain of marijuana has soothing properties, so it helps treat various medical conditions. For example, it helps with chronic pain, insomnia, inflammation from arthritis, muscle spasms, and nausea.
